Volcano plots of the gene expression changes in icv-STZ mice and 3xTg-AD mice.
<p>Fold changes (FC) in gene expression of icv-STZ mice vs. control mice (A) and 3xTg mice vs. control mice (B). Each dot represents one gene. Green, down-regulated; red, up-regulated.</p
RNA integrity.
<p>Total RNA samples (1.5 µg/lane) extracted from mouse brains were separated in 1.2% native agarose gels and visualized under ultraviolet light.</p
